Summary of Bill HR 5247
Bill 117 HR 5247, also known as the Reducing Obesity in Youth Act of 2021, aims to address the growing issue of obesity among children and adolescents in the United States. The bill focuses on implementing strategies to promote healthy eating habits and physical activity in young people in order to reduce the prevalence of obesity.
Key provisions of the bill include funding for programs that support nutrition education in schools, increasing access to healthy foods in underserved communities, and promoting physical education and active lifestyles among youth. The bill also calls for research and data collection on obesity trends in order to better understand and address the root causes of the issue.
Overall, the Reducing Obesity in Youth Act of 2021 seeks to combat the rising rates of obesity among young people by implementing comprehensive strategies that promote healthy behaviors and lifestyles. By addressing this issue early on, the bill aims to improve the overall health and well-being of America's youth.

Congressional Summary of HR 5247
Reducing Obesity in Youth Act of 2021
This bill requires the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, in coordination with the Administration for Children and Families, to award grants to nonprofits, institutions of higher education, or consortia of these entities to promote healthy eating and physical activity and address food insecurity among children in early care and education settings.

Current Status of Bill HR 5247
Bill HR 5247 is currently in the status of Bill Introduced since September 14, 2021. Bill HR 5247 was introduced during Congress 117 and was introduced to the House on September 14, 2021. Bill HR 5247's most recent activity was Referred to the Subcommittee on Health. as of September 15, 2021
